The European Securities and Markets Authority (ESMA) has published an update of its list of central clearinghouses (CCPs) which are authorised under the European Markets Infrastructure Regulation (EMIR) and its Public Register for the Clearing Obligation.
CME Clearing Europe has been authorised to extend its activities and services to clear short term interest rate futures (STIRs) and deliverable swap futures (DSFs).
